So I just had my wisdom teeth out today (they put me out for it, and other than slight jaw discomfort I'm just fine).

My problem is for the next few days I can't eat anything I really have to chew (soft breads, noodles, and that sort of thing are all okay). I'm trying to make a plan for what I'm going to eat tomorrow, and I'm having a hard time getting as much protein as I'd like.

Other than eggs, and chicken broth, can anyone think of anything? I was pondering tofu, but I'd rather not just eat it plain, but can't think of anything that is made out of it but keeps in spongy. Maybe tofu dogs? I know special k makes protein water, is that any good? I suppose SlimFast probably has protein as well, but I'm not a big fan of it.
